Abstract EN

In this paper, we proposed a radiation pattern reconfigurable waveguide slot array antenna using liquid crystal (LC).

Together with the waveguide slot, the designed complementary electric-field-coupled resonator functions like a switch controlled by the dielectric constant of the LC, which can control the antenna element to radiate or not.

Thus, the array factor and radiation pattern can be manipulated.

The proposed antenna was simulated, fabricated, and measured.

Its radiation direction can be reconfigured to 46° or 0° at about 15 GHz.
